VEHLIVE BT911 Multi-Function Battery Tester User Manual

Model: BT911

1. Introduction

The VEHLIVE BT911 is an advanced multi-function battery tester designed for comprehensive analysis of 6V, 12V, and 24V batteries. It offers dual circuit testing for 12V and 24V systems, ensuring stable and accurate results. This device is equipped with an upgraded chip for faster and more precise diagnostics, achieving over 99.99% accuracy. It supports a wide range of battery types and provides detailed reports on battery health, cranking capabilities, and charging system performance. The BT911 is suitable for various vehicles including cars, motorcycles, trucks, SUVs, ATVs, boats, and yachts.

4. Product Features

  • Dual Voltage Detection: Supports 6V, 12V, and 24V battery systems.
  • Wide CCA Range: Tests batteries with 5-3000 CCA.
  • Comprehensive Battery Tests: Includes State of Health (SOH), State of Charge (SOC), CCA value, voltage, and internal resistance.
  • Cranking Test: Analyzes actual starting voltage and time, diagnosing starter system performance.
  • Charging Test: Detects changes in battery voltage, checks and analyzes the alternator's charging system (load, no-load, ripple).
  • Voltage Waveform Analysis: Real-time tracking of voltage changes for problem detection.
  • High Accuracy: Over 99.99% testing accuracy with rapid results.
  • User-Friendly Interface: 2.8-inch high-contrast color LCD screen and 9 silicone buttons for easy operation.
  • Multi-Language Support: Supports 12 languages including English, Chinese, Japanese, Korean, Italian, Dutch, German, Russian, Portuguese, Spanish, French, and Polish.
  • Wide Compatibility: Suitable for various vehicle types and battery standards (JIS, EN, DIN, SAE, CCA, BCI, CA, MCA, IEC).
  • Safety Protections: Reverse polarity, over current, ABS shell, over temperature, anti-spark safe clips, and short circuit protection.

6. Setup

  1. Unpack the Device: Carefully remove the BT911 tester and its accessories from the packaging.
  2. Inspect for Damage: Check the device and cables for any visible damage. If damaged, do not use and contact support.
  3. Connect to Battery: Connect the red clamp to the positive (+) terminal of the battery and the black clamp to the negative (-) terminal. Ensure a secure connection. The device will power on automatically.
  4. Initial Settings: The device will display the main menu. You may need to select the battery voltage (12V or 24V) and battery location (In-Vehicle or Out-of-Vehicle) for the first test.

7. Operating Instructions

7.1. Battery Test

  1. From the Main Menu, select 'Car' or 'Motorcycle' depending on your vehicle.
  2. Select the battery voltage (12V or 24V).
  3. Choose 'In-Vehicle' or 'Out-of-Vehicle' for the battery location.
  4. Select 'Battery Test'.
  5. Follow the on-screen prompts: Check surface charge, turn lights on for about 10 seconds, then turn lights off.
  6. Select the battery type (e.g., Regular Flooded, AGM Flat Plate, GEL).
  7. Select the battery standard (e.g., CCA, IEC, EN, DIN, CA, BCI, SAE, JIS, MCA).
  8. Set the battery rating (e.g., 400A CCA). Use the arrow keys to adjust the value and 'OK' to confirm.
  9. The tester will display the results including SOH, SOC, R (internal resistance), CCA, STD (standard rating), and VOL (voltage).

7.2. Cranking Test

  1. From the Main Menu, select 'Car' or 'Motorcycle'.
  2. Select the battery voltage (12V or 24V).
  3. Choose 'In-Vehicle' or 'Out-of-Vehicle' for the battery location.
  4. Select 'Cranking Test'.
  5. The device will prompt you to turn off the engine before pressing OK.
  6. Then, it will prompt you to start the engine.
  7. The tester will monitor the cranking voltage and cranking time, displaying MAX and MIN voltage values and a 'Normal' or 'Abnormal' status.

7.3. Charging Test

  1. From the Main Menu, select 'Car' or 'Motorcycle'.
  2. Select the battery voltage (12V or 24V).
  3. Choose 'In-Vehicle' or 'Out-of-Vehicle' for the battery location.
  4. Select 'Charging Test'.
  5. The tester will analyze the alternator's charging system, displaying 'Load' voltage, 'No load' voltage, and 'Ripple' voltage, along with a 'Normal' or 'Abnormal' status.

8. Maintenance

  • Keep the device clean and dry. Wipe with a soft, damp cloth if necessary.
  • Avoid exposing the device to extreme temperatures, direct sunlight, or high humidity.
  • Store the device in its original packaging or a protective case when not in use to prevent damage.
  • Regularly check the diagnostic cables and clamps for wear and tear. Replace if damaged.

9. Troubleshooting

ProblemPossible CauseSolution
Device does not power onIncorrect battery connection; Battery completely dead.Ensure clamps are securely connected to the correct battery terminals. Check battery voltage with a multimeter; if too low, charge the battery before testing.
Inaccurate test resultsLoose connections; Incorrect battery parameters entered.Verify all connections are tight. Double-check the entered battery type, standard, and CCA rating.
Screen is blank or frozenSoftware glitch; Power issue.Disconnect and reconnect the device to the battery. If the issue persists, contact customer support.
Error message during testSpecific test conditions not met; Internal fault.Refer to the specific error code (if any) in the full manual. Ensure all pre-test conditions (e.g., engine off for cranking test) are met.

10. User Tips

  • For the most accurate battery test results, ensure the battery is fully charged and has rested for at least 30 minutes after charging or use.
  • When performing the Cranking Test, always follow the on-screen instructions to start the engine only when prompted.
  • Utilize the Voltage Waveform Analyzer to visually identify intermittent issues or unusual voltage drops that might not be apparent in static test results.
  • Keep the clamps clean and free of corrosion to ensure good electrical contact.
